Will Crawford is currently employed as a Senior Designer at EF Educational Tours since June 2019. Prior to this position, Will worked as a Designer at KGBTexas Communications from October 2016 to May 2019. Will graduated from Trinity University in 2015.
This person is not in the org chart
This person is not in any teams
This person is not in any offices